Last Updated at 11 October 2024DHATLA M.S.K.: A Rural Upper Primary School in West Bengal
DHATLA M.S.K. is a government-run upper primary school located in the rural area of Kashipur block, Purulia district, West Bengal, India. Established in 2007 under the Department of Education, this co-educational institution caters to students from classes 5 to 8. The school's primary language of instruction is Bengali.
The school building, while government-provided, lacks a boundary wall and electricity. However, it boasts one classroom in good condition, along with additional rooms for non-teaching purposes and a dedicated space for the school's teachers. Despite these limitations, the school provides a crucial educational service to the community.
One key feature of DHATLA M.S.K. is its commitment to providing mid-day meals, prepared and served on the school premises. This ensures students receive proper nourishment, supporting their learning and overall well-being. Access to clean drinking water is also ensured through functional hand pumps located within the school grounds.
The school's facilities include separate functional toilets for boys and girls, demonstrating a commitment to hygiene and gender inclusivity. Furthermore, the presence of a playground provides a vital space for recreation and physical activity, complementing the academic curriculum. The lack of a library and computer-aided learning facilities, however, presents opportunities for future development and enhancement.
The school's teaching staff consists of three teachers, with two male and one female educator. This dedicated team works to provide quality education to the students, despite the resource constraints. The school is easily accessible via an all-weather road, ensuring consistent student attendance. The academic year at DHATLA M.S.K. begins in April.
